[QUOTE="nooner, post: 12074682, member: 101093"] The sound you describe seems to be an exact description of what I heard from my stock clutch when I bought the car, kind of sounded like sheet metal slapping against something. And I could feel it in the pedal. A new clutch quadrant and firewall adjuster eliminated that noise. Or maybe that's not the same noise, I don't know. When first installed, mine engaged at the top of the pedal as well, but my mechanic was able to adjust it down close to the middle of travel without having to go to an adjustable pivot ball. It's perfect now. But there was something wrong with your setup (install or parts?) because engagement travel should be very small, and it shouldn't make any noise. Mine doesn't. I can't say much about Mcleod tech support because I only spoke to them once (about converting an RST to an RXT) but they answered my questions satisfactorily. Sorry to hear you had a bad experience with the RXT because I think you are missing out on a great clutch. [/QUOTE]
